Parliamentarian Zouhir Naceri asked the Minister of Health, Abderrahmane Benbouzid, to provide clarification on the measures that his ministerial department will take regarding the subject of the intention of 1,200 Algerian doctors to leave to work in France.
Yesterday Thursday, Naceri has put an oral question to the Minister of Health, Abderrahmane Benbouzid, asking him if the minister’s services would seek to “fix things before they degenerate and cause more difficult complications for Algerian society”.
The FLN deputy also wondered whether Minister Benbouzid would seek to “coordinate with the parties” he deems competent to study the phenomenon “in depth, and arrive at solutions satisfactory to all parties”.
Zouhir Naceri concluded his oral question, asking the Minister of Health if he considers that “the general financial and social situation of doctors” is one of the reasons for their emigration, asking “if there are any inaccuracies and other reasons”, to be specified.
